Wilpshire is known for its green spaces and residential feel, with easy access to local countryside walks and nearby parks around the Ribble Valley. Everyday amenities can be found in Wilpshire and along Whalley Road, with a wider range of facilities available in Blackburn.
Transport connections are convenient. Ramsgreave & Wilpshire railway station is the nearest train station, typically within a short drive or reasonable walk, and provides services towards Blackburn, Clitheroe with connections onwards to Preston, Manchester and other regional centres. Road links from Wilpshire allow straightforward access to the A666 and A59, supporting commuting by car across East Lancashire and towards the M6 and M65 corridors.
